The previous article on Soul Stones covered the basic concept, now here are a few specific examples to include in your game.

I think your players will appreciate that the Soul Grenade can be used as both a rechargeable healing tool, and an effective combat weapon, adding a bit of added versatility in the form of controller power to anyone who cares to make the sacrifice and hurl it into a group of enemies. The ability to blast a bunch of bad guys with a magical pulse of mind warping emotion is very cool, but the loss of such a handy healing trinket will make the experience somewhat bitter sweet, after all, that is a level 13 magical item they just smashed into a million pieces!

Second item on offer, a weapon crafted out of Soul Stone.

I am very fond of the idea that this item could fall into the hands of the party prankster, who makes wicked use of it, spreading lust and ecstasy with every sweep of the blade. And of course, the idea of a bunch of Kobolds hit with a blast of lust from a Soul Grenade is just.. well, that could bring combat to a hilarious finish in one fell swoop if done right, which would be just as well, since the player characters might just be paralyzed with laughter.
That is, until they see a bit too much and become more than a little revolted.
